Phone SIP - Phone SIP implements a SIP (Software-Based Input Panel), a kind of Pocket PC virtual keyboard, allowing you to write text using traditional cellphone input.
The panel is still at a very early development stage - and not really complete in functionality, but it gives a general idea of how it would work out.

Supported operating systems:
Pocket PC 2002, Windows Mobile 2003, Windows Mobile 5.0
